黄河流域生态保护与高质量发展耦合协调关系实证分析

扫码查看
为准确把握黄河流域生态保护与高质量发展的耦合协调关系,以黄河流域 9 个省(区)全域为研究对象,基于 2016-2020年面板数据,采用熵值法、耦合协调模型对黄河流域生态保护与高质量发展的耦合协调关系进行了实证分析.结果表明:2016-2020 年黄河流域生态保护水平和高质量发展水平均呈上升态势,生态保护水平的区域格局由"下游高、中上游低"变为"中上游高、下游低",高质量发展区域格局由"上中游高、下游低"变为"上中游低、下游高";黄河流域生态保护与高质量发展耦合协调状况基本属于相互协调型,呈现由高质量发展相对滞后型向生态保护相对滞后型转变的趋势;研究期内,黄河流域生态保护与高质量发展耦合协调水平整体较低但呈稳步上升趋势,耦合协调等级大致经历了"轻度失调—濒临失调—勉强协调"的转变过程,今后还有较大提升空间.
Empirical Analysis of the Coupling and Coordination Relationship Between Ecological Protection and High-Quality Development in the Yellow River Basin
In order to accurately grasp the coupling and coordination relationship between ecological protection and high-quality development in the Yellow River Basin,the coupling and coordination relationship between ecological protection and high-quality development in the Yellow River Basin was empirically analyzed by using the entropy method and coupling coordination model based on the panel data from 2016 to 2020.The results show that from 2016 to 2020,the level of ecological protection and high-quality development of the Yellow River Basin are on the rise,the regional pattern of ecological protection level changes from"high downstream,low in the middle and upper reaches"to"high in the middle and upper reaches and low downstream",and the regional pattern of high-quality development changes from"high in the upper and middle reaches and low downstream"to"low in the upper and middle reaches and high downstream".The coupling and coordina-tion of ecological protection and high-quality development in the Yellow River Basin are basically of the mutual coordination type,showing a trend of transformation from a relatively lagging type of high-quality development to a relatively lagging type of ecological protection.During the study period,the coupling coordination level of ecological protection and high-quality development in the Yellow River Basin is lower but steadily increasing,and the coupling coordination level roughly undergoes the transformation process of"mild imbalance-imminent imbalance-barely coordination"and there is still much room for improvement in the future.
